✨ Thai Dancer Thai Ginger Sauce for quick, aromatic Thai-style cooking

Thai Dancer Thai Ginger Sauce brings the warm, zesty character of ginger into an easy-to-use sauce. It’s aromatic and lively, making everyday stir-fries, noodles, and rice dishes taste more distinctly Thai without needing a long list of seasonings.

Use it as a wok sauce, a finishing drizzle, or a simple dip base. It pairs especially well with chicken, tofu, shrimp, and crunchy vegetables—great when you want a fast dinner with clear ginger notes.

🍽️ How to use

  • Stir-fry sauce: add near the end of cooking with sliced vegetables and your chosen protein
  • Noodle toss: mix into cooked noodles with a splash of cooking water for a glossy, fragrant finish
  • Rice bowl topper: drizzle over jasmine rice with steamed greens and a fried egg
  • Simple dip: combine with a little lime juice and chopped spring onion for dumplings or grilled skewers
  • Marinade idea: coat tofu or chicken briefly before pan-searing for extra ginger aroma

🧾 Ingredients

soy paste (soy, wheat flour, salt, water, sugar), water, sugar, red chilli, ginger 6%, garlic, distilled vinegar, sweet soy sauce (soy, sugar, water, glucose syrup, salt), corn starch, stabilizer: E415, flavor enhancer: E621, preservative: E211.

🧾 Allergens

soybeans, wheat

🧾 Nutrition facts

Energy (kJ) - 480 kJ

Energy (kcal) - 110 kcal

Fats - 1.7 g of which saturated 0.3 g

Carbohydrates - 20 g of which sugars 18 g

Protein - 2 g

Salt - 6.7 g

Fiber - 3.5 g

Do not rely solely on the information provided for the product in our online store! Although we strive to always have up-to-date information on our products, the manufacturer may change the recipe and thus the composition. Always check the information directly on the product packaging, especially if you are on a special diet. Keep in mind that even foods that do not list allergens in their ingredients may still contain some. For example, in the case of gluten, a food containing up to 20 mg/kg of gluten is considered gluten-free and can be labeled as such. Up to 50 mg/kg of gluten is considered a trace amount, and labeling as gluten-free and information about trace amounts is voluntary.

We only sell long-life products that do not require special conditions. However, these are still food products, and when shopping online, it is important to remember that a few days in a box in the sun or, conversely, in the cold can have a negative effect on the quality of the food purchased.

Pay attention to the expiration date and type of shelf life.
Use by/expiration date = after this date, it is not safe to eat the food.
Best before = after this date, the quality may decline, but consumption is usually safe if the packaging is intact and the food still smells and tastes good.
